The Unlikely Beginning
H1: A Handover That Changed Everything
On December 14, 1983, when Prime Minister Indira Gandhi handed the keys of the first Maruti 800 to Harpal Singh, it was a symbolic moment that transformed India’s mobility landscape forever.
